  • What weather, wildlife, or natural hazards might affect travellers in Sherwood Forest, United Kingdom?

    The weather in Sherwood Forest can be unpredictable. Pack for all conditions; warm layers are essential even in summer, and waterproof outerwear is advisable year-round. Wildlife encounters are generally safe; deer are common, and you might spot various birds. However, be mindful of ticks, especially during warmer months. There are no significant natural hazards, but sticking to marked paths is always advisable.

  • Is Sherwood Forest, United Kingdom pedestrian and cyclist-friendly?

    Sherwood Forest has a good network of well-maintained paths suitable for walking and cycling. Many trails are clearly marked, and there are designated cycle routes. However, be aware that some paths can be muddy after rain, and some areas might be challenging for those with mobility issues. Cycling is a popular way to see more of the forest.

  • Are there any recommended items to pack for a stay in Sherwood Forest, United Kingdom?

    For a trip to Sherwood Forest, pack comfortable walking shoes, waterproof and warm layers of clothing, a hat, sunscreen, insect repellent (especially tick repellent), a map or GPS device, and a reusable water bottle. Binoculars are also useful for wildlife spotting. If cycling, ensure your bike is in good condition and you have appropriate safety gear.
